trivet

Signification (Anglais)

  1. A stand with three short legs, especially for cooking over a fire.
  2. A stand, sometimes with short, stumpy feet, or a mat used to support hot dishes and protect a table; a coaster.
  3. A weaver's knife used to cut out the wire that was used to form a pile.
